一、现象:照片传来传去,怎么就变模糊了?
你可能经历过这样的瞬间:
-
收到朋友发来的合同照片,字迹模糊不清;
-
群聊里转发的截图,越传越糊,最后根本看不清;
-
发朋友圈的照片明明很清晰,别人一看却像打了马赛克。
很多人下意识地怪手机摄像头、怪软件“不走心”,但其实这背后,是图像压缩算法在“努力为你好”。
今天,我们就来看看:照片为什么越传越糊?图像是怎么被压缩的?你又该如何尽量保住清晰度?
二、图像其实是一堆数字组成的
在计算机世界里,图像 = 大量像素点的集合。每个像素都有颜色信息,通常由三组数字(RGB)表示:
-
R(红)、G(绿)、B(蓝):每项通常是 0~255 的整数;
-
一张 4000×3000 的照片 = 1200 万像素 × 每像素 3 字节 ≈ 34MB 原始数据。
这也是为什么原图看起来清晰无比——因为每一个像素都完整地保留了。
三、压缩的必要性:体积太大,传输太慢
34MB 一张的照片,如果每张都这么大:
-
你朋友圈一刷 10 张图 = 340MB,加载不开;
-
软件服务器一天处理几亿张图,成本爆表;
-
网速慢一点,图片加载时间堪比过年回家路。
于是,“图像压缩”就被广泛使用。
压缩分两类:
-
✅ 无损压缩:不丢信息,可以100%还原(如 PNG);
-
✅ 有损压缩:舍弃部分“肉眼看不出”的信息,减小体积(如 JPEG、WebP);
在实际使用中,大部分社交平台和软件,都默认使用“有损压缩”来减小图片大小。
四、有损压缩怎么“压”?图像信息去哪了?
拿 JPEG 举例,它的压缩过程并不简单,而是巧妙地模拟了人眼的视觉偏好:
Step 1:颜色转换
图像先从 RGB 转换到 YCbCr 模式 —— 分成亮度(Y)和色彩(Cb/Cr)
👉 因为人眼对亮度更敏感,对色彩变化不敏感
Step 2:色度降采样
把 Cb/Cr 分量“平均处理”掉一些信息
👉 例如 4:2:0 模式下,色彩信息减少到 1/4
Step 3:8×8 分块
将图片切成一个个 8x8 的小块单独压缩
👉 也是造成“马赛克感”来源之一
Step 4:DCT 变换
把图像信息转化为“频率”信息
👉 高频 = 细节,低频 = 模糊轮廓
Step 5:量化处理
重点来了:系统会“主动丢弃”高频信息
👉 人眼对这些变化不敏感,可以牺牲一点点
Step 6:编码与存储
将保留下来的数据编码成更小的文件
结果就是:一张 34MB 的照片,可能只剩下 2MB,加载快了,服务器轻松了,但...代价是:细节不可逆地流失了。
五、“越传越糊”的真正原因:重复压缩
初次压缩后虽然肉眼看不出,但当你:
-
截图 → 压缩 → 再截图 → 再压缩...
-
每次转发,平台都重新压一次图...
这些“压缩后的图再压缩”叠加下来,图像就会快速劣化:
-
高频信息已经不多,再压只会更模糊;
-
色彩会偏移,文字边缘失真,图像块感加剧;
-
最终呈现出“糊”“虚”“锯齿”的惨状。
六、“高清原图”也可能不是原图?
很多人以为“发送高清图”就是发送原图,其实未必:
-
微信的“高清图”仍然是压缩版本;
-
真正“发送原图”需要用户主动点击“原图发送”选项;
-
有的平台干脆限制最大像素宽度(如不超过 2048px),即使你图再高清,也会被自动缩小。
换句话说——“高清”这个词,平台说了算,跟你理解的不一定一样。
七、如何保住照片的清晰度?
✅ 以下这些小技巧能帮你避免“越传越糊”:
-
传原图而不是压缩图:手动勾选“发送原图”;
-
别反复截图:从源头获取原图,避免多代截图;
-
用“文件发送”而非“图片发送”:压缩往往只对图片触发;
-
使用网盘链接传图:如坚果云、阿里云盘、iCloud 分享链接;
-
保存重要图片时选高质量格式:如 PNG、HEIC、RAW;
-
避免社交平台二次发布:先本地编辑,最后统一发出。
八、延伸:图像格式的进化之路
格式 | 是否有损 | 特点 |
---|---|---|
JPEG | ✅ 有损 | 兼容性好,压缩效率高 |
PNG | ❌ 无损 | 支持透明,适合图标和图文 |
WebP | ✅ 可选 | Google 推出,兼顾体积与质量 |
HEIC | ✅ 有损 | iPhone 默认格式,压缩高效 |
AVIF | ✅ 可选 | 新兴格式,质量优异但支持度较低 |
未来的图像格式越来越智能,但压图的本质不会变:以更小的代价,保留更多“你看得见的质量”。
九、总结:压缩不是偷工减料,而是权衡艺术
图像压缩并非“把图压烂”,而是用最少的数据呈现最清晰的图像——
-
它理解人眼的局限,主动“舍弃”看不见的;
-
它让图像在低网速下也能加载;
-
它背后,是工程与艺术的平衡。
只不过,当你需要保留更多细节,就要“对抗默认”,掌握发送高清图的技巧。不是你手机差,是软件太聪明。
📎 延伸阅读推荐:
或者关注我的个人创作频道:点击这里